Value Analysis of Soft Foundation Construction Monitoring System: A Holistic Upgrade from Technology to Management
1. Pain Points in Engineering Management: The Interest Game Between Owners and Contractors
- Owner’s Demand: Pursuit of high-quality engineering aligned with design standards to ensure structural safety and long-term benefits.
- Contractor’s Consideration: Balancing compliance with cost control to maximize project profits.
- Core Conflict: Striking a balance between quality and cost efficiency.
2. Introduction of Third-Party Monitoring Systems: Rebuilding Trust Through Technology
To prevent quality defects or material fraud, owners increasingly adopt Soft Foundation Construction Monitoring Systems. These IoT-based systems digitize critical processes, including material ratios, construction parameters, and pile quality, enabling transparent, data-driven management.
3. Key Monitoring Stages and Technical Implementation
-
Material Ratio Monitoring
- Cement Mixing Process:
- Monitored Parameters: Water-cement ratio, admixture proportions, slurry density.
- Equipment: Integrated monitoring systems at mixing stations to automate data recording and reduce manual intervention.

-
Slurry Transportation Monitoring
- Pump Outlet Monitoring:
- Installed Devices: Pressure sensors, flow meters, density meters.
- Function: Real-time monitoring of slurry quality (pressure, flow rate, density) to ensure transport stability.

-
Pile Machine Operation Data Collection
- Sensor Configuration:
- Flow meters, density meters, depth sensors, inclinometers, ammeters, and velocity sensors.
- Data Integration: Based on the BeiDou Navigation Satellite System, generating 3D pile models and distribution maps.

-
Pile Quality Verification
- Post-Curing Testing: Cross-check monitoring data with field test results to validate construction consistency and prevent fake pile driving.

5. Industry Transformation Through Technology: From "Reactive Management" to "Proactive Prevention"
- Limitations of Traditional Models: Reliance on manual records and spot checks, leading to data delays and human interference risks.
- Technological Advantages:
- Real-Time: Immediate data upload with automated anomaly alerts.
- Precision: Multi-sensor integration builds comprehensive quality profiles.
- Sustainability: Long-term cloud storage supports future maintenance and audits.
